Ticket #FR-Storage — Spare Hardware Room, Ketterill Plaza

Reception now manages sign-out for the spare hardware room on the mezzanine. Please log each item taken, including cables, on the clipboard inside the door, and verify returns against it at end of day. Keep the door fully closed; it does not self-latch. The keypad code for the room is below.

staff pass of yahag-tagaf = bdg-NGQCI-9

- [ ] **Step 7: Breaker override escrow.** After sealing the signing keys for the Tallgrove upstream API circuit breaker, confirm the support team can force the breaker open during a full outage. The override bundle lives in the sealed escrow drawer and is useless without its unlock phrase. Two ceremony witnesses must initial this step before proceeding. The escrow bundle is decrypted with the recovery passphrase that follows.

vault phrase of kahip-kahop = holath-quenmir

# ReportForge Environments

Welcome aboard! ReportForge runs dev, staging, and prod. The gotcha for newcomers: report exports are timezone-sensitive. Dev pins everything to UTC, but staging and prod resolve timestamps per-tenant, so exports can look "wrong" if you compare across environments. Always check which environment generated the file. Each environment's timezone behavior comes from the settings below.

service settings:
PRAIX_LOG_LEVEL=error
PRAIX_METRICS_HOST=metrics.praix.qorvelcorp.corp
PRAIX_POOL_SIZE=16